The Buenos Aires ePrix is an annual race of the single-seater, electrically powered Formula E championship, held in Buenos Aires, Argentina. It was first raced in the 2014-15 season.[1]
Circuit
File:Largada y grilla.jpg
Puerto Madero Street Circuit, previous to the 2015 Buenos Aires ePrix.
The Buenos Aires ePrix is held on the Puerto Madero Street Circuit, a street circuit located in the Puerto Madero district of Buenos Aires. It was used for the first time on 10 January 2015 during the fourth ePrix of Formula E. The track is 2.44 km in length and features 12 turns. The circuit was designed by Santiago García Remohí.[2][3][4]
